The roma bag came in Ferro which is a gunmetal grey color from fall/winter. It's a great dark color that is not black.

Old Petra is a chameleon of a color; in some lights it is brownish with hints of purple, in other lights it is truly mauve. It's a special color that you have to see in person to truly appreciate.
